Electronic Park Brake Module Not Activated
C10D0 is an OBD-II diagnostic trouble code meaning: Electronic Park Brake Module Not Activated. Common causes: broken or corroded wiring harness, epb module malfunction. Estimated repair cost: $56–222.
Symptoms
- EPB fault light is on
- Electronic parking brake does not work
- Error persists after activation attempt
Causes
- Broken or corroded wiring harness
- EPB module malfunction
- Module power problems
- Software failure in the control unit
- Incorrect adaptation after service
How to Fix
- Check EPB module wiring harness and connectors
- Check fuses and module power supply
- Scan the control unit for additional errors
- Adapt the EPB module (if required)
- Replace EPB module if necessary
